MySQL 8.0.32快速安装与Java集成教程

5星 · 超过95%的资源 需积分: 23 28 下载量 88 浏览量 更新于2024-10-11 1 收藏 439.26MB ZIP 举报
资源摘要信息: "MySQL8.0.32安装程序和jar包" 是指包含了MySQL数据库管理系统版本8.0.32的安装程序,以及适用于Java语言操作MySQL数据库的JDBC驱动程序jar包。这个资源特别适合数据库管理员、开发者、测试人员以及任何需要与MySQL数据库交互的Java应用程序的开发者。 MySQL是一个广泛使用的开源关系型数据库管理系统(RDBMS),由瑞典的MySQL AB公司开发,后被甲骨文公司(Oracle Corporation)收购。8.0.32是MySQL的一个版本号,表示这是一次特定的更新迭代。 在了解"MySQL8.0.32安装程序和jar包"之前,需要先了解几个基本的概念: 1. **安装程序**:通常是一个可执行文件或脚本,用于在计算机系统上安装MySQL数据库软件。安装程序包含了安装过程所需的所有文件、设置和配置选项,用户通过执行安装程序即可将MySQL数据库安装到目标计算机上。 2. **MySQL Connector/J**:这是MySQL官方提供的JDBC(Java Database Connectivity)驱动程序。JDBC是一种Java API,使得Java程序可以连接到数据库并进行数据操作。MySQL Connector/J允许Java应用程序通过标准的JDBC接口与MySQL数据库进行通信,执行SQL语句,以及进行数据的增删改查等操作。 3. **JAR包**:JAR(Java Archive)是一种打包Java类文件、图片、声音等资源文件的压缩包格式,可以在Java平台上被当作一个单一实体处理。在本例中,mysql-connector-j-8.0.32.jar文件就是包含MySQL JDBC驱动的JAR包,它允许Java应用连接并使用MySQL数据库。 4. **数据库与Java的交互**:Java作为一种编程语言,要操作数据库通常需要通过JDBC驱动来实现。通过加载和使用JDBC驱动(在本例中是mysql-connector-j-8.0.32.jar),Java程序能够实现对MySQL数据库的连接、查询、更新以及管理等操作。 具体到MySQL8.0.32的安装和使用,以下是详细的步骤和知识点: **安装MySQL8.0.32**: - 下载MySQL8.0.32安装程序(mysql-installer-community-*.*.**.*)。 - 执行安装程序,根据安装向导选择安装的组件,例如服务器、客户端工具、文档等。 - 在安装过程中配置数据库服务器的相关设置,例如端口号、数据文件存储位置、字符集设置等。 - 完成安装后,启动MySQL服务,并可能需要设置root用户的密码以及其他安全相关的配置。 - 使用MySQL客户端工具连接数据库,例如命令行工具(mysql命令)或图形界面工具(如phpMyAdmin, MySQL Workbench等)进行后续的数据库管理工作。 **在Java中使用MySQL JDBC驱动**: - 将mysql-connector-j-8.0.32.jar文件添加到Java项目的类路径(classpath)中。 - 使用JDBC API编写Java代码来连接MySQL数据库。通常需要加载驱动类,建立连接,创建语句(Statement)或预编译语句(PreparedStatement),执行SQL查询或更新,处理结果集等步骤。 - 通过JDBC提供的Connection对象进行数据库连接,Statement对象用于执行SQL语句,ResultSet对象用于处理返回的数据集。 在安装和配置过程中,常见的问题包括: - 端口冲突,需要确保MySQL使用的端口号没有被其他应用占用。 - 权限设置不当,可能会导致连接或操作数据库时权限不足。 - 驱动版本与数据库服务器版本不兼容,应确保JDBC驱动与MySQL服务器版本相匹配。 - Java版本与JDBC驱动版本不兼容,需确保二者相互兼容。 最后,"MySQL8.0.32安装程序和jar包" 对于开发者和管理员来说,是一个非常实用的工具,可以在进行开发、测试或生产环境部署时,实现快速的MySQL数据库环境搭建和应用部署。而对于数据库的日常维护和优化,则需要进一步学习MySQL的高级特性和管理技巧。